研究概览

简要总结

The research focuses on establishing a system for detecting loss of consciousness, developing clinical prognostic and awakening-related brain function testing criteria.

详细描述

A framework for the acquisition of neural features, feature selection and mechanism analysis of consciousness deficits in patients with acute and prolonged disorders of consciousness(DOC). Based on the multimodal data of three types of patients with DOC, the investigators established a comprehensive scientific collection of brain function features of acute and prolonged consciousness disorders; Revealed the key neural nodes and circuits of consciousness deficits, and elucidated the neural mechanisms of consciousness deficits in patients with prolonged consciousness disorders from EEG time-frequency-spatial features;

结局指标

主要结局

Change from TEP in electroencephalogram

时间窗: Assessment within 24 hours before, and 1 hour after TMS treatment

Assessment the TMS Evoked Potential(TEP)

Change from Coma recovery scale-revised

时间窗: Within 24 hours of enrollment

CRS-R scale includes 6 dimensions such as audiovisual, arousal level, verbal response, motor and communication, scoring 0 to 23, the higher the score the better the neurological function, and each score reflects the presence or absence of the evaluated person and the strength of consciousness

Change from the p300 in electroencephalogram

时间窗: Assessment within 24 hours before, and 1 hour after TMS treatment

Assessment the p300 in event related potential(ERP)

Change from resting-state in electroencephalogram

时间窗: Assessment within 24 hours before, and 1 hour after TMS treatment

Assessment the spectral power and coherence by in resting-state EEG

Change from PCI in electroencephalogram

时间窗: Assessment within 24 hours before, and 1 hour after TMS treatment

Assessment the perturbational complexity index(PCI) in TMS-EEG
